Leave the Smart charger alone.. it only has a 2 amp out put.. I would suggest going for a charger that has a minimum of a 3amp out put...


As a Suggestion, try for the Best charger you can afford...

I like the Triton JR

http://www3.towerhobbies.com/cgi-bin...&I=LXMAH9&P=ML


As a minimum
http://www3.towerhobbies.com/cgi-bin...?&I=LXCLD5&P=7
It has 3amp output means that a 3000mah Battery will be done in 60mins
